Add a section with columns then change back without losing continuous page numbering in word 2010
How do I change to columns then back to normal pages in a long document without losing the continuous page numbering and the same with one page needing to be landscape instead with portrait
Page number restarts are controlled at the section level, and when you insert columns, Word adds section breaks to text. To get continuous page numbering in Word, use the "Continue from previous section" option in the Page Number Format dialog box (Insert
tab | Page Number | Format Page Numbers). This must be done for all sections in the document.
